GENERAL ASSEMBLY OF NORTH CAROLINA

SESSION 2001

 

 

SESSION LAW 2001-42

SENATE BILL 831

 

 

AN ACT TO EXTEND THE DEADLINE FOR THE GOVERNOR TO APPOINT THE STATE CONTROLLER TO JUNE 15, 2001.

 

 

The General Assembly of North Carolina enacts:

 

SECTION 1.  Notwithstanding G.S. 143B-426.37(b), the Governor shall have until June 15, 2001, to submit the name of the person to be appointed as State Controller, for confirmation by the General Assembly, to the President of the Senate and the Speaker of the House of Representatives.

SECTION 2.  This act is effective when it becomes law and shall expire on June 30, 2001.

In the General Assembly read three times and ratified this the 1st day of May, 2001.
